![]() I put an old school Lee CCS in my fuge a couple days ago. The tank is in the bedroom and the airpump is annoying me at night. I was thinking about putting it on a timer so it only skims during the day. Will only skimming 14-16 hours per day cause any problems with the tank, will it be of any benefit? Does anyone know about how to set this thing for maximum benefits? I have no instructions.
The skimmate it produces at the moment is thin watery green tea looking stuff. TIA Brad |

![]() Thats about all the lee's will produce. As long as you are doing regular water changes running the skimmer part time should be ok. I'd think about getting a better skimmer though. I was running a lee's, and now a SS65. What a difference in skimate. this stuff is almost black!
